Career path
| Career Role (3D Printing Housing) | Description |
|---|---|
| 3D Printing Technician (Additive Manufacturing) | Operates and maintains 3D printing equipment, ensuring optimal performance and quality in housing construction. |
| Architectural 3D Modeler (Housing Design) | Creates detailed 3D models for housing projects using advanced software, incorporating sustainable design principles and 3D printing techniques. |
| Construction Manager (3D Printed Housing) | Oversees all aspects of 3D printed housing construction, from planning and design to project completion. Manages budgets and timelines. |
| Structural Engineer (Additive Manufacturing) | Designs and analyzes the structural integrity of 3D printed housing components, ensuring compliance with building codes and safety regulations. |
| Material Scientist (Construction 3D Printing) | Researches and develops new construction materials suitable for 3D printing, focusing on sustainability and performance. |
